%N A195348 Decimal expansion of shortest length, (A), of segment from side AB through incenter to side AC in right triangle ABC with sidelengths (a,b,c)=(1,sqrt(3),2) and vertex angles of degree measure 30,60,90.
%C A195348 See A195284 for definitions and a general discussion.
%e A195348 (A)=0.7578747639260239988121867474270095303467925401944...
%e A195348 (A)=(4*sqrt(6-3*sqrt(3)))/(3+sqrt(3))
%e A195348 (B)=2-(2/3)sqrt(3)
%e A195348 (C)=sqrt(6)-sqrt(2)
